Walter C. Keffer

2 min read

Walter C. Keffer, age 68, of Monarch, Pa., died Saturday, December 23, 2006, in the Intensive Care Unit at Highlands Hospital, Connellsville, Pa. He was born October 15, 1938, in the home he had lived in his whole life to loving parents, the late James W. and Esther A. Oldland Keffer.

Walter was a loving son, brother, uncle, nephew and friend to all who knew him.

He was a beloved caregiver to his mother for many years until her passing in 1996.

Walter was a very family-oriented man. During his brief stay in the hospital, his main concern was for his family to not worry about him or his health.

For most of his life he was involved with the arrangements and preparation of the yearly Oldland family reunions.

He will be remembered for his dedication to his family and friends.

“Walt” was a kind person and a prankster to all who knew him.

Walter is survived by the following brothers: James W. Keffer of Monarch and formerly of the Washington, D.C., area, Clarence W. “Bud Keffer and his wife Cynthia (Langham) of Uniontown, Pa., and John E. Keffer of Monarch, Pa.; and a special niece, Christine R. Keffer and her husband William Reinhard of Uniontown, Pa. He is also survived by several aunts and numerous cousins and friends.

Friends will be received on Tuesday from 2 to 4 and 7 to 9 p.m. and Wednesday in the BROOKS FUNERAL HOME INC., 111 East Green Street, Connellsville, Pa., where Services will be held on Thursday, December 28, at 11 a.m. with the Rev. Mary Ann Long officiating.

Interment will follow in Green Ridge Memorial Park, Pennsville, Pa.
